Agile project management emphasizes continuous improvement, flexibility in scope, team collaboration, and delivering high-quality products. This modern approach to project management breaks down large projects into smaller, more manageable tasks, making it adaptable to various industries and organizational needs, while ensuring faster delivery and higher stakeholder satisfaction.

Today, Agile is widely used by software developers, construction firms, educational institutions, and marketing teams. Its simplicity and versatility make it a valuable methodology for organizations of all types, fostering increased efficiency, adaptability, and innovation in project delivery.
